Ways Of Car Shipping: Enclosed Car Transport

 

Brand new, rare and expensive cars are transported to their destination through enclosed car transport. The closed car shipping method places a vehicle inside a safe metal enclosure and stays there locked until it reaches the final point of destination. This method is preferred by most car dealers and manufacturers since they are confident that their vehicles will reach their drop-off points in exactly the same condition that they were in before they were transported.

The main feature of enclosed car shipping that open shipping cannot offer is almost 100% protection from all kinds of harm throughout the time when the vehicles are being shipped. This assurance can give considerable comfort to the car owner since many things can happen during the tranfer.

While open car shipping securely straps vehicles on board the car deck or vessel platform, this uncovered method cannot protect vehicles from harsh weather conditions.

Enclosed car transport protects the shipment from heavy rains, acid rain, hail, sleet, snow and even dust storm and other environmental hazards that can hit anytime. Other probable dangers that can harm the vehicles on board open carrier trucks are road debris such as gravel, pebbles and dust that may have been blown by strong winds. The tiniest airborne particle could scratch your car’s body paint or damage your windshields

A variety of enclosed car transport is rail shipping. Cars are placed exclusively inside rail cargo containers and are shipped by rail. One of the most popular car rail movers is Amtrak.

The special attention and care given to the vehicles make enclosed car transport more expensive than open car shipping. Some shipping companies offer cargo containers with climate control features. Other companies even put on a protective cloak over the vehicle that is already perfectly safe inside the locked container.

The most common vehicles that are shipped this way are a Lamborghini, Hummer, Jaguar, Rolls Royce, Ferrari and the like. (Get the idea?) Sports cars, antique automobiles, and hard-to-find models could not be risked being shipped onboard an uncovered carrier truck. Sometimes, when the military has run out of resources or time that they cannot ship their own vehicles, they hire private car shipping companies and request for enclosed car shipping service.

Long distance or overseas shipping could be hard on the automobiles if not done through enclosed shipping. As uncovered cars are strapped on board the deck of a Roll-On Roll-Off vessel or RORO, the wind over saltwater sea can lead to corrosion and cause tiny scratches. RORO vessels do not tip over and cars for shipping do not normally get into serious problems, but then again it is not wise to ship expensive cars this way.

Enclosed car transport guarantees complete safety from environmental hazards as well as people who might want to ‘sample’ or damage the unattended cars. No one can even lay a hand on your car that could unintentionally scratch it or create a dint. If safety and protection is the car owner’s ultimate concern, enclosed shipping is the only option. The only catch is that the car owner should have a bigger car shipping budget.
